复杂汽车冲压零件成形工艺分析

摘    要:在复杂零件冲压成形过程中,合理的成形工艺是保证生产合格零部件、降低生产成本的关键.本文根据零件冲压工艺要求和结构特点进行成形工艺分析,制定了拉深冲孔→切边冲孔→翻边整形的工艺方案.随后对其成形过程进行了模拟,以在成形过程中零件不出现破裂、材料变薄率最小为优化原则,对影响成形质量的因素如坯料尺寸、拉延筋的结构形式进行了分...

Analysis of Forming Process for the Complicated Stamping Parts

Abstract:According to the stamping process requirements and structural features,the forming process of drawing & punching→trimming & punching→flanging & plastic has been established in the text.Then the forming process has been simulated.Taking the non—broken part and minimum thinning rate of material in the forming process as the optimization principle,the factors,which affect the forming quality,such as the blank size and the structure of the drawbead,have been analyzed.It shows that the structure and distribution of the drawbead has important influence to the forming quality.
